According to esoteric history, there have been several stages of development of human consciousness:
– Lemuria with the development of the body and the etheric/physical plane
– Atlantis with the development of emotions and the astral plane
We are currently at the stage of developing the mental plan, which would have to be constructed, structured and developed. This mental plane is often associated with the intellect, perceived as negative by cutting off the relationship with our body. Isolated in the twists and turns of our head, separated from feelings and emotions, emptied by the energy that the brain uses to function… The mental plane is only just beginning, and therefore its limiting and negative aspects are mastered first. In the same way that a child discovers his physical body by staggering and learning to walk, today’s human being discovers his mental body by learning to use all the functionalities and capacities of his brain.
And our brain is the organ through which we connect to the mental plane. We must not forget that human cognitive abilities have made immense progress since the appearance of reason through scholastic education at the end of the Middle Ages. The Enlightenment allowed an unprecedented advance in the capacities of abstraction and individualization of minds. The human brain and more generally the mental plane have undergone very significant progress in recent centuries.
The majority of the brain’s currently developed capabilities concern its lower aspects. Because like each plane, it is subdivided into several parts depending on the vibrational tone of this plane of consciousness. There are lower aspects, such as analysis, repetition, intellect, calculation… Then there are higher aspects such as intuition, creativity, discernment, enlightened and revealed knowledge… It is by cultivating as a priority the highest and most evolving aspects of the brain that it will be possible to develop the full potential of the mind. And more generally, this will cause the mental plane to evolve through us.
